No.2ベストアンサー
- 回答日時:
こんばんは!
一例です。
↓の画像で説明させていただきます。
Sheet1のデータをSheet2に五十音別に表示するようにしています。
Sheet1に作業用の列を2列設けています。
作業列D2セルに
=IF(A2="","",PHONETIC(A2))
E2セルに
=IF(D2="","",COUNTIF($D$2:$D$1000,"<"&D2)+COUNTIF($D$2:D2,D2))
という数式を入れ、D2・E2セルを範囲指定し、オートフィルで下へずぃ~~~!っとコピーします。
(E列の数値はD列が空白でも数式が入っていればカウントしてしまいますので、
かなりかけ離れた数値になると思いますが、あまり気にしなくてOKです。)
そして、Sheet2のA2セルに
=IF(B2="","",ROW(A1))
B2セルには
=IF(COUNT(Sheet1!$E$2:$E$1000)<ROW(A1),"",INDEX(Sheet1!A$2:A$1000,MATCH(SMALL(Sheet1!$E$2:$E$1000,ROW(A1)),Sheet1!$E$2:$E$1000,0)))
という数式を入れ、列方向(画像ではD2セルまで)オートフィルでコピーします。
最後にA2~D2セルを範囲指定し、D2セルのフィルハンドルでオートフィルで下へコピーすると
画像のような感じになります。
これで、Sheet1のデータに増減があってもSheet2にちゃんと反映されると思います。
尚、数式はSheet1の1000行目まで対応できるようにしていますが
データ量によって範囲指定の領域はアレンジしてください。
以上、長々と失礼しました。
参考になれば良いのですが・・・m(__)m
有り難う御座います。
現在、名簿作成の担当を引き継ぎまして、悪戦苦闘している最中です。
前任者のが色々入り組んでいて、参照がよく分からない表になっています。
引き継ぎできるようにと思っているのですが、なかなかそうも上手くいきそうにないですね。
でも、これだけの詳細の説明をつけて頂くと、表の説明に大変役に立ちます。
たいへん助かりました。有り難う御座います。
No.1
- 回答日時:
Excelで名前の読みを漢字に変換したのでしたら、名前の列を並べ替えの対象にすることで五十音順になります。
他からコピーしてきたり、違う読みを変換したりして作成したのでしたら無理。
読み仮名に関する情報が正しく Excelに入力されていません。
読み仮名に関する情報が無い場合は、漢字やひらがななどのコードで並べ替えが行われます。
ですので異音どころか名前として並べ替えを行っているのにとんでもない順番に並んだりします。
<例>
あ:JISコードで 2422
阿:JISコードで 3024
この場合、別途仮名を入力してその列を対象に並べ替えを行ってください。
この回答への補足
早速の回答有り難う御座います。
並べ替えでも良いのですが、登録者が、常ではありませんが、増減します。
出来れば、元表を参照し、増減した場合でも、別表には、一覧として五十音順に空白行無しに並んでいると言うのがほしいのです。
関数で出来ないでしょうか?
ややこしいこといってすいませんが、宜しくお願いします。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- その他(パソコン・スマホ・電化製品) エクセルに詳しい方にお伺いします。50人ぐらいの住所録ですが、フィルターで五十音順に並べ替えたら、一 6 2023/08/07 18:49
- Excel(エクセル) Excelのソート(並べ替え) 2 2022/05/15 22:54
- その他(スマートフォン・携帯電話・VR) あなたの電話帳、登録件数が多いのは何行ですか 5 2022/11/13 17:09
- Excel(エクセル) Excelで漢字人名が勝手に並び変わる 2 2023/01/14 22:14
- Excel(エクセル) Excel 効率的な名簿と得点の管理の仕方 8 2022/08/07 08:15
- Visual Basic(VBA) Excel VBAで並べ替えをしたい 3 2023/02/25 09:31
- Excel(エクセル) Excelでの並べ替えについて 5 2022/11/26 22:18
- Excel(エクセル) Excel 郵便番号順に並び変えたい 同じ番号が複数あるとき 4 2022/04/28 18:35
- Excel(エクセル) Excelで漢字人名が勝手に並び変わる(続) 4 2023/03/21 21:28
- Excel(エクセル) Googleスプレッドシートの割合の関数と円グラフの並べ替えについて 1 2022/07/22 17:31
このQ&Aを見た人はこんなQ&Aも見ています
-
性格の違いは生まれた順番で決まる?長男長女・中間子・末っ子・一人っ子の性格の傾向
同じ環境で生まれ育っても、生まれ順で性格は違うものなのだろうか。家庭教育研究家の田宮由美さんに教えてもらった。
-
エクセルで名簿を50音で切り分ける
Excel(エクセル)
-
Excelで並び替え後にア行カ行などをつけたい
Excel(エクセル)
-
エクセルでシートの並び替えですが・・・
Excel(エクセル)
-
-
4
EXCELふりがな、並び替えでなく順位表示
Excel(エクセル)
-
5
関数で、名簿順で入力すると同時に別シートへ
Excel(エクセル)
-
6
【マクロ】あいうえお順のシートに振分けしたい
Excel(エクセル)
-
7
エクセル SMALL の機能を文字列でもできないか
Excel(エクセル)
-
8
エクセル:項目を自動で50音のシートに分け、対応する項目を抜き出したいのですが・・・
Excel(エクセル)
-
9
関数式の入った列で五十音順のソートをすることは可能ですか?
Excel(エクセル)
-
10
Excel 文字をあ行、か行に変換する方法
Excel(エクセル)
関連するカテゴリからQ&Aを探す
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
【スプレドシート】IMPORTRANGE...
-
会社のOutlookにてメールを予約...
-
「生産性ソフトウェア」とは何...
-
英数字のみ全角から半角に変換
-
Microsoft familyに追加されま...
-
会社PCのメールが更新されない
-
outlookのメールが固まってしま...
-
Microsoft Formsの「個人情報や...
-
VBAファイルの保存先について
-
Microsoft 365 の一般法人向け...
-
エクセルでXLOOKUP関数...
-
マイクロソフトオフィス
-
teams設定教えて下さい。 ①ビデ...
-
Outlook 電源OFFの受診の仕方
-
Excel2019と365、2021
-
Microsoft365の一部を解約したい
-
Excel テーブル内の空白行の削除
-
Outlookを立ち上げたらGoogleロ...
-
Outlook で宛先が複数の場合の人数
-
マクロ1があります。 A1のセル...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
【スプレドシート】IMPORTRANGE...
-
英数字のみ全角から半角に変換
-
Excelで空白以外の値がある列の...
-
会社PCのメールが更新されない
-
Excel 日付を比較したら、同じ...
-
マイクロソフト 一時使用コード...
-
ウィンドウィズ メモ帳で日付だ...
-
MicrosoftOfficeの1ユーザー2...
-
Microsoft Formsの「個人情報や...
-
Officeの字体
-
エクセルでXLOOKUP関数...
-
Microsoft365で自動保存が出来...
-
Outlookで、任意のメールアドレ...
-
outlookのメールが固まってしま...
-
Microsoft 365 の一般法人向け...
-
Office2021を別のPCにインスト...
-
Microsoft 365のディフェンダー...
-
Excelに貼ったリンクについて E...
-
MicrosoftOffice2019なんですが、
-
Outlook で宛先が複数の場合の人数
おすすめ情報